css三中定义模式

admin 轻心小站 关注 LV.19 运营
发表于前端技术学习版块 css,教程

CSS(层叠样式表)是用于描述文档风格和呈现的样式语言。为了让CSS能够更好地工作,在定义CSS时采用三种定义模式:标准模式(Strict Mode)<br> 格式:&am

CSS(层叠样式表)是用于描述文档风格和呈现的样式语言。为了让CSS能够更好地工作,在定义CSS时采用三种定义模式:

标准模式(Strict Mode)<br>
格式:<!DOCTYPE html><br>
标准模式中,浏览器按照Web标准来呈现页面。该模式要求HTML代码严格遵循标准语法,以确保页面在不同的浏览器中具有相同的呈现效果。

混杂模式(Quirks Mode)<br>
格式:无DOCTYPE声明<br>
混杂模式中,浏览器忽略标准的HTML语法和CSS规则,使得页面能够在早期的浏览器中呈现出来。但是我们不推荐使用混杂模式,应当全面抵制该模式的使用。

准标准模式(Almost Strict Mode)<br>
格式:<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><br>
准标准模式介于标准模式和混杂模式之间,在此模式下,浏览器尽可能按照Web标准来呈现页面,但是允许部分“传统”的页面行为。 
实际上一般都是用的标准模式,这也是W3C推荐并建议使用的模式。使用标准模式的优点是:页面排版稳定、样式表协作性好,且在不同浏览器中呈现效果基本相同。

文章说明:

本文原创发布于探乎站长论坛,未经许可,禁止转载。

题图来自Unsplash,基于CC0协议

该文观点仅代表作者本人,探乎站长论坛平台仅提供信息存储空间服务。

评论列表 评论
发布评论

评论: css三中定义模式

粉丝

0

关注

0

收藏

0

已有0次打赏